Signs Your Pipes May Need Relining

If you’re not certain whether or not your pipes require relining, here’s some signs to look for:

  • Water leakage
  • Unpleasant odors emanating from your drains
  • You hear gurgling noises coming from the drains
  • Clogs or slow drainage

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We cannot reline a collapsed pipe. If you’ve got a collapsed pipe then you’ll need replacement of the pipe. If you’re not certain how damaged your pipe is you are able to have us come out and conduct an inspection for you.

Does Pipe Relining Reduce The Pipe Flow?

There is typically no reduction in the flow of pipes because of the relining of pipes. Relining pipes is often a way to increase the amount of flow through the pipe since it creates the new smooth surface for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Around?

Pipe relining has been used for a long time, with the first documented case dating back to 1854. However, it was not until the 2000’s when it started to become more popular.

Today, pipe relining technology is widely used around the world as an efficient method to fix leaky or damaged pipes without the need to remove them and replace them completely. There are many different types of pipe relining solutions which can be utilised according to the type of pipe used and the severity of what the issue is.

For instance, there’s spot pipe relining Kallista, which is used for small leaks, as well as structural pipe relining, which is used to repair more severe damage. Whichever type of pipe relining is used in the project process, the purpose is the same: repair the pipe, without needing to replace the entire pipe.
